Enlisted Unaccompanied Personnel Housing at Eglin AFB, FL
Solicitation # enlisted-unaccompanied-personnel-housing-eglin-afb-fl
The Enlisted Unaccompanied Personnel Housing project at Eglin Air Force Base in Florida involves the construction of two two-story barracks buildings. Each 120-bed facility will feature 32 units, with each unit containing a kitchen, dining area, living area, and laundry room. Common building amenities include a lobby, elevator, entrance vestibule, exercise room, day room, lounge, and dedicated mechanical, electrical, and communications rooms. The project scope also encompasses extensive site work, including the development of parking areas for vehicles and motorcycles, roadways, concrete sidewalks, grading, a storm sewer system, utilities, and landscaping. Additional site amenities will include a large open pavilion, a basketball court, and a volleyball court. Managed by Roy Anderson Corp, this solicitation is open to a wide range of small business set-asides, including SDB, WOSB, HUBZone, VOSB, and SDVOSB. The comprehensive scope of work covers diverse functional categories such as demolition, concrete, masonry, steel, roofing, HVAC, fire protection, and electrical systems. The contract strictly adheres to equal opportunity regulations, incorporating Executive Order 11246, Section 503 of the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, and the Vietnam Era Veterans Readjustment Act of 1974. Bids for labor, materials, supervision, and equipment must be submitted by August 18, 2026, at 1:00 PM CT.

NJCC Bathroom Renovations for Buildings 17 & 18
Solicitation # njcc-bathroom-renovations-buildings-17-18
The Northlands Job Corps Center in Vergennes, Vermont, is seeking bids for a fee-for-service sub-contract to perform complete bathroom renovations in two dormitory buildings. The project involves renovating four distinct bathroom areas totaling approximately 944 square feet in Building 17 and five distinct areas totaling approximately 1,260 square feet in Building 18. Work includes multi-stall student shower, toilet, and vanity spaces, as well as single-user bathrooms. All construction must adhere to ADA, OSHA, National Electrical Code, and NFPA Standard No. 101 Life Safety Code requirements. To maintain center operations, contractors must renovate the dormitories one at a time. Bidders may submit a unified proposal for both buildings or standalone bids for each. Required submission materials include a completed bid sheet with an itemized cost breakdown separating materials and labor, a proposed project schedule, current Vermont state professional licensing, and standard vendor paperwork such as Form W-9 and a Vendor Acknowledgement Form. The response deadline is September 14, 2026. Award selection is at the sole discretion of ETR, and the lowest bid does not guarantee an award. Payment terms are net 30 days upon receipt of a proper invoice and proof of goods or services. Final project closure requires a signed punch list and applicable warranties. This opportunity is set aside for various small business categories, including SDB, WOSB, HUBZone, VOSB, and SDVOSB.
